The not negotiables!

To join our team you must:

  • Be eligible to work in Australia
  • Hold current registration with the Victorian Institute of Teaching if you want to teach!
  • Hold a current Working with Children Check for every role other than teaching
  • Be willing to submit a current (no more than 2 months old) National Criminal Record Check
  • Be willing to undertake a medical check for manual labour or high risk
